Heres what happened. The test kits that were shipped had one reagent that was faulty. That meant there might be some false positives and false negatives, so the CDC decided everything needed to keep going through them. However, the CDC decided Tuesday or Wednesday (after Pence took over oversight) that it was okay to use the test with 2 of the 3 reagent working, that the tests would be reliable enough and testing really couldnt wait. So the health depts are using those tests.
Cases that test positive by the local health department are considered presumptive cases until verified by the CDC, but the CDC said to treat the cases as if they are already confirmed.
In addition, the FDA has loosened regulations so that health departments can use their own tests.
